Technical characteristics of Xiaomi WPB15PDZM: hull?
Before you go to the instructions, it is worth understanding the "stuffing" of the device. WPB15PDZM It is equipped with lithium polymer batteries from LG or Samsung (depending on the batch), which guarantees stable operation and protection against overheating:
| Characteristics | Meaning |
|---|---|
| Capacity | 10,000 mAh (real-world) ~6500-7000 mAh for smartphones) |
| Entrance port | USB-Type-C (5V/2A, 9V/2A, 12V/1.5A) |
| Outlet ports | 1Γ USB-A (5V/2.4A, 9V/2A, 12V/1.5A) + 1Γ USB-Type-C (5V/3A, 9V/2A) |
| Support for fast charging | Quick Charge 3.0, Power Delivery, Apple 2.4A |
| Weight/size | 223 s / 147.8 Γ 71.6 Γ 14.2 mm |
Pay attention to the real capacity: due to losses during voltage conversion and heating, you will only get 65-70% of the declared 10,000 mAh. For example, a smartphone with a battery of 4000 mAh can be charged from 0 to 100% about 1.5-1.7 times, and not 2.5, as many people think.
Another important thing is that you can charge two devices at the same time, so if you connect them to both ports, the total power is distributed between them, for example, when you charge a smartphone through a port. USB-A and headphones through Type-C total current will not exceed 3A, slowing down.

How to Charge Xiaomi WPB15PDZM: rules and prohibitions
Charging a power bank is not just about plugging in. How you do it depends on whether the device lasts 2 years or fails in 6 months.
- π Use the power adapter 18Wβ30W (Optimally, it's Xiaomi original. Weak blocks (5W) Increase the charging time 3-4 times and heat the battery.
- π‘οΈ Do not charge at a temperature below 0Β°C or higher than 40Β°C. Optimal range: 10β30Β°C.
- β±οΈ Full charging takes 4-5 hours (when used) 18W If the process is delayed to 8+ Check the cable or port.
- π Don't leave the device on charge for more than 24 hours. Modern controllers turn off power after 100%, but reinsurance won't hurt.
Pay special attention to the charging indicators. WPB15PDZM There are 4 LEDs that show the level of charge:
- π΄ 1 LED - 0-25%
- π‘ 2 LEDs - 25-50%
- π’ 3 LEDs - 50-75%
- π΅ 4 LEDs - 75-100%
If the indicators do not light up or flash chaotically when connected to the outlet, this may indicate:
- π Faulty cable or adapter (try another one)
- π Type-C port pollution (clean with a soft brush)
- π οΈ Controller failure (reset or repair required)

How to charge other devices from WPB15PDZM: compatibility and limitations
Xiaomi WPB15PDZM It's universal, but it's not omnivorous. That's what you can and can't plug into it:
| The device | Can I charge? |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Smartphones (iPhone, Xiaomi, Samsung) | β Yes. | Supports Quick Charge and Power Delivery |
| Wireless headphones (AirPods, Redmi Buds) | β Yes. | Better use the port. USB-A |
| Fitness bracelets (Mi Band, Huawei Band) | β Yes. | Current 1A fast-charging |
| Tablets (iPad, Xiaomi Pad) | β οΈ Partially. | Charging, but very slowly (required) 30W+) |
| Laptops (MacBook, Xiaomi Book) | β No. | Powers 18W feeding |
For maximum charging speed, use:
- π± For the iPhone, port USB-A Lightning Cable (supported by Apple) 2.4A)
- π€ For Android smartphones β Type-C port with cable USB-C β USB-C
- π§ For headphones, any port, but better USB-A (lesser)
If the device is not detected or charged too slowly:
- Try another cable (preferably original).
- Reboot your smartphone/tablet.
- Clear the port on the power bank of dust.
- If the problem remains, reset the settings. WPB15PDZM (press the button for 10 seconds).

Typical Problems and Solutions: Why WPB15PDZM doesn't work?
Even the most reliable device can fail, and here are the most common problems and ways to fix them:
| Problem. | Possible cause | Decision |
|---|---|---|
| It's not charging from the socket. | Faulty cable/adapter, contaminated port | Try another cable, clear the port. |
| Does not charge connected devices | Controller failure, deep discharge | Reset settings (15 seconds), charge fully |
| Quickly discharged (holds) <50% from the declared capacity) | Battery wear, lack of calibration | Perform 3 cycles of discharge / charging |
| Overheating during work | Use of non-original cable, high load | Turn off the load, let it cool down. |
| Indicators burn chaotically | Controller firmware failure | Reset the settings or contact the service |
If the power bank has stopped turning on completely, try the following:
- Connect to charging for 30 minutes (even if the indicators are not on).
- Press the button for 20 seconds, sometimes it wakes the controller.
- Try charging from another source (e.g., another manufacturerβs power bank).
- If nothing works, bring it to the service. Self-repair of lithium polymer batteries is dangerous!
β οΈ Attention: If the body WPB15PDZM If you swell or smell a fire, stop using immediately, it's a sign of battery damage that could cause fire, dispose of the device according to local electronics recycling regulations.
